| Notably this article is about offsets, not cap and trade.
|
| Cap and trade is fundamentally different from offsets in that
| there is a central authority who decides precisely what caps
| every company gets before trading starts, so every transaction
| which increases one company's cap by 1 ton is guaranteed to
| decrease another's.
|
| Offsets are a decentralized attempt to quantify how various
| actions would lower the world's carbon output compared to some
| estimate of what would happen otherwise. The cheapest offsets
| prey on this ambiguity in the various ways the article
| suggestions.
|
| The other big difference is that cap and trade is mandatory
| while offsets are optional. There is so little offset-buying
| happening now that the markets are artificially cheap.
| Companies currently claiming to be "carbon neutral" would
| certainly be unable to afford doing so if it was required of
| every company (similar to if the "cap" was universally zero
| carbon, a clear non-starter today).

| The deep problem with the more common "avoided emissions"
| credits is not that they're low quality (e.g. "protecting" a
| forest that might just burn down) -- though some are indeed low
| quality. The deep problem is that if I pay you to halt your
| emissions, who is going to pay me to halt mine? That's the
| shell game aspect. We start out with two emitters, we halt one,
| we never do anything about the other. One emitter is "done"
| because they're no longer emitting, and the other emitter is
| "done" because they've purchased an offset. The model is broken
| at its core.

| The problem is with "avoided emissions" offsets. Suppose X
| and Y are both emitting greenhouse gases, and X pays Y to
| stop. That's a half solution, but it is often treated as a
| complete solution: X looks good because they bought an
| offset, and Y looks good because they're no longer emitting
| anything. That's the shell game.
|
| Concretely, let's consider rainforest preservation. This is
| critically important, and plausibly (I don't actually know a
| lot about it) requires payments to relevant actors in places
| like Brazil. So yes, as a society, we need to come up with
| money for those payments. But we need to come up with that
| money in a way that doesn't let some _other_ polluter
| permanently off the hook for _their_ emissions. If an airline
| pays to protect some rainforest, says "hey look an offset",
| and declares victory, how will we ever address the airline's
| emissions? We've done some good in the short run (we
| accelerated the effort to preserve the rainforest), but then
| we arrive at a dead end.
|
| Cap-and-trade systems avoid this problem, if all of the
| buyers and sellers of credits are part of the system, and the
| cap is gradually reduced to zero. But if a company says "my
| plan to reach net zero relies heavily on purchasing offsets",
| outside of a cap-and-trade system that eventually squeezes
| avoided-emissions offsets to zero, then we're back to the
| shell game.

| The problem with carbon offsets is not some moral
| question about my offloading my guilt to another party.
| The problem is that there's double-counting. Going back
| to the scenario, "suppose X and Y are both emitting
| greenhouse gases, and X pays Y to stop". Let's break that
| down:
|
| 1. Initially, X is emitting greenhouse gases. I'm not
| sure moral terminology is helpful here, but for the sake
| of discussion, we can say X is "guilty".
|
| 2. Initially, Y is also emitting greenhouse gases, they
| are also "guilty".
|
| 3. X makes a payment to Y, and Y halts their emissions.
|
| If we say that Y is no longer guilty, because they
| stopped emitting, then we must say that X is still
| guilty.
|
| If we say that X is no longer guilty, because they
| purchased an offset from Y, then we must say that Y is
| still guilty: they started out guilty, and they sold off
| the rights to their compensating action (halting
| emissions) to X.
|
| We started with two guilty parties, and only one
| compensating / atoning action was performed. There is no
| coherent framework in which it can be said that both
| parties are now innocent.

| An acre of forest sequesters somewhere in the region of
| 30,000 lbs of carbon dioxide. Individual trees die and are
| reborn, but the forest as a whole, if it does not shrink,
| retains that carbon.

| But it's even more complicated than that ...
|
| We are reforesting ~20 acres of woodland just outside of
| San Francisco and we are not, as you say, thinking about
| individual trees - we are thinking of the woods as a
| whole ...
|
| ... which means clearing out a tremendous amount of
| sapling / deadwood / litter material that would quickly
| combust in a wildfire and destroy the entire forest.
|
| So while we are on track for planting >200 redwood and
| douglas fir trees, we have also had to cut down >100
| marginal trees to reduce fuel load. We're thinking on the
| scale of the entire forest and the entire forest needs to
| survive a burn ... including our relatively new trees
| that aren't as fire resistant as the old growth redwoods
| that were originally logged out of here.
|
| Generally speaking:
|
| The complexity of carbon mathematics is fraught and
| complex and I don't think it's reasonable to expect end
| users like consumers to navigate it.
